Members of the public have a rare chance to enjoy the Area 27 racetrack in Oliver at full throttle.

Cars for a Cause is a fundraiser being held in support of the Okanagan Similkameen Neurological Society Child Development Centre. Anyone can purchase a ticket to be a passenger in a McLaren, Ferrari, Porsche, Lamborghini, Aston Martin or Dodge Viper on July 20.

“Area 27 members are generously donating their time and luxury cars to provide a co-pilot experience to those seeking a thrill,” reads a media release. “While you’re waiting for your session, view cars lapping on track from the berm or take a walk through our show’n’shine area featuring gorgeous local cars.”

The most expensive 30-minute rides cost $640.34. Some of those include riding in a 2018 Lamborghini Huracán, 2022 McLaren 675LT Spider and 2023 Porsche GT3 RS.

The most affordable options start at $214.33 for 30 minutes – that can buy a ride in a 2019 Chevrolet Camaro SS 1LE, 2002 Honda S2000, 2007 Mazda MX5 Race Car and 2014 Supercharged Ariel Atom. Find a list of all the vehicles and pricing here.

Co-pilots will receive several laps in the car of their choosing and will be permitted to bring up to two guests with them to spectate, according to the event's description.

Money raised through Cars for a Cause will benefit children with developmental challenge.

This event was only held once before in July 2019 and over $100,000 was raised.
